  1. Walter Eugene Massey (born April 5, 1938) is an American educator, physicist, and executive. President Emeritus of both the School of the Art Institute of Chicago (SAIC), and of Morehouse College, he is chairman of the board overseeing construction of the Giant Magellan Telescope.   5. Mar 19, 2024 · The day before Walter Massey turned 30, in 1968, the Rev.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. was fatally shot on a hotel balcony in Memphis. Dr. Massey, then a physicist at Argonne National Laboratory, watched the funeral on television, in tears, from his apartment in Chicago. Outside, the west side of the city was burning.

  8. Feb 20, 2010 · Dr. Walter E. Massey was appointed the ninth director of the National Science Foundation (NSF) by President George H. W. Bush in 1991, the 40th anniversary year of the foundation.
